How to Successfully
Market Your Women’s Healthcare Program
and Build Community Awareness
MANASQUAN,
N.J. — June 20, 2008 — Most Healthcare executives know that
today's women make 85% of all household healthcare decisions, including
choice of doctor and hospital loyalty.
Traditional healthcare marketing does NOT work for
women.
Many women’s health professionals say they are challenged
with finding new and creative ways to reach women with an effective,
compelling message.
If issues surrounding getting women to participate and getting them
excited about their health sounds familiar, you’re not alone.
Marketing plays a big part in the overall success of a
program. You
have to have a strategy to address competition from other hospitals,
women’s health professionals have told us. One women's health marketing director said, “We need
to set ourselves apart.”
How do you get the attention of the important community leaders?
To be successful in marketing to women, healthcare organizations must
know why health and wellness is important to women in their
multi-dimensional roles as consumers, caregivers, career women and
community leaders. Women act on their health when there is
simultaneous appeal to their hearts, minds, bodies, and spirit.
How can your organization capture the attention and gain the loyalty of
women in your community? The good news is that simple
adjustments to your marketing can make a huge impact in a relatively
short amount of time.
